What to look for in AC & Furnace Replacement in Flint

A whole-system changeout is the moment to right-size with a Manual J load calc and match the coil, condenser, and air handler so the rated efficiency is real. We weight installers who publish matched-system practice, manufacturer authorization, and Manual J sizing for the full job.

  • Whole-system / matched install. Provider names AC-plus-furnace or air-handler system replacement with the AHRI-matched combination — not two separate, unmatched halves.
  • Manufacturer authorization + labor warranty. Factory-authorized status and a multi-year labor warranty preserve coverage across the whole new system.
  • Manual J sizing. An ACCA Manual J load calculation right-sizes the system instead of copying the old (often oversized) equipment.

Verify before you book

  • Whether a Manual J load calculation was actually performed — ask to see the load-calc result.
  • That the coil, condenser, and air handler form an AHRI-certified combination — request the AHRI Reference Number.
  • License status with your state board — verify TDLR (TX), ROC (AZ), DBPR (FL), or your local equivalent before paying.

What Flint homeowners actually ask about "AC Replacement" — answered with local details

Should I replace the AC and furnace at the same time?
If both are near end of life, replacing together gives you one matched, right-sized system, one labor mobilization, and aligned warranties — often cheaper than two separate jobs. If only one has failed and the other is newer, a good installer confirms the AHRI match instead of upselling the pair.
Does replacing both as a system improve efficiency?
Yes, when it's done as a matched set. The rated SEER2 only holds for an AHRI-certified combination of condenser, coil, and air handler, and a whole-system changeout is the moment to right-size with an ACCA Manual J load calculation rather than copying the old equipment.
Can a contractor handle combined AC and furnace replacement in Flint, and what should be verified?
Many Flint contractors install matched AC and furnace systems, but homeowners should verify the contractor performs combined load calculations and offers matched-system warranties. Confirm electrical panel capacity and permit handling for any gas or electrical work tied to the combo replacement.
How do I find a high-efficiency AC replacement specialist in Flint?
Look for contractors who perform Manual J load calculations, list high-efficiency models, and document expected Seasonal Energy Efficiency Ratio (SEER). Check for manufacturer-dealer relationships and written warranty terms. Read recent local reviews that mention cooling bills or efficiency improvements.
